How it works
The motor is the main part of a robot vacuum, as it generates suction to draw dirt and other debris out of the vacuum bag. Some robot cleaners have a combination roller brushes, side brushes and mops to agitate and raise particles into the suction. Some come with smart features, such as the ability to automatically return to the dock once it is full and recharge. Others offer integrated smart home integration and voice activation, allowing users to control the machine with your smartphone app or your personal assistant.
Sensors aid robots in navigating their surroundings, avoiding obstacles and tight corners. Sensors such as obstacles and cliff sensors are used to stop robots from falling down stairs or getting stuck under furniture. Certain robots have dirt sensors that inform you when the robot is dirty and has to be cleaned. Many of the latest robot mop and vacuum models come with many smart features, including smart mapping and smart mops that differentiate between hard floors and carpets.
Some robot vacuums with mop attachments have a multi-function dock that can automatically empty the bin and clean the mop pads, and refill the water tank. Cleaning time
The majority of robot vacuum cleaners have a water and dust reservoir that need emptying However, mop machines also require that their cleaning pads cleaned in order to increase the running time of the device. The time it takes to clean a room could also be affected by how many obstacles the robot has to face and whether it has to push furniture, stay clear of socks and shoe tassels or find its way around messy rooms.
Certain robotic vacuums and mop systems are able sense carpets, and adjust their power settings in line with. However, Robot Hoover and Mop they may still leave behind some dirt, particularly on high-pile or shag rug. Some models require more power to maneuver through carpets that are very thick which can make batteries drain faster.
Other factors can affect the performance of a robot, including the condition of its accessories and how often it needs to be maintained. A tangled brush can stop the robot vacuum that mops from doing its job. A filthy or full-blown filter could cause it to overheat or even disconnect from the Internet.

All robot vacuums and mops require regular maintenance, which includes emptying the bin cleaning the filter and changing filters and bags. In addition, you'll have regularly clean the sensors for better navigation, and empty and rinse the water tank. Also, you'll need to take out tangles and clogs off the brush roll and other components, particularly on combo units with a vacuum mop.
